Abstract
A method and apparatus for reducing power consumption in a mobile device of a wireless communication system when discovering a central node is provided. The method for operating of a terminal for discovering at least one central node in a wireless communication system includes: generating a probe request signal and transmitting the probe request signal to at least one central node; after transmitting the probe request signal, switching from a normal mode to a low power mode and driving the terminal in the low power mode; in response to a mode switch instruction signal being received from the central node, switching the terminal from the low power mode to the normal mode; and receiving a probe response signal to the probe request signal from the central node in the normal mode.

9. A method for operating a central node of a wireless communication system, the method comprising:
-
generating a probe response signal in response to a probe request signal being received from at least one terminal; waiting for the probe response signal to be transmitted; transmitting an instruction signal to the terminal, wherein the instruction signal includes instructions to switch the terminal from a normal mode to a low power mode; and transmitting the probe response signal to the terminal. - View Dependent Claims (10, 11, 12, 13, 14, 15, 16)

25. A central node of a wireless communication system, the central node comprising:
-
a receiver configured to receive a probe request signal from at least one terminal; a controller configured to generate a probe response signal in response to the probe request signal being received, wait for the probe response signal to be transmitted, and generate an instruction signal to instruct to switch the terminal from a normal mode to a low power mode; and a transmitter configured to transmit the instruction signal and transmit the probe response signal to the terminal after transmitting the instruction signal. - View Dependent Claims (26, 27, 28, 29, 30, 31, 32)
